Under the Coolibah Tree is a 1955 Australian musical by Dick Diamond. It was Diamond's follow up to his successful musical Reedy River and like that used bush folk songs.[2]
It debuted in Brisbane in 1955 and had a season at the New Theatre in Sydney.[3] The musical was also performed at the Melbourne Olympic Arts Festival.[4]
